Luteolin 7-malonylglucoside

3-{[(2R,3S,4S,5R,6S)-6-{[2-(3,4-dihydroxyphenyl)-5-hydroxy-4-oxo-4H-chromen-7-yl]oxy}-3,4,5-trihydroxyoxan-2-yl]methoxy}-3-oxopropanoic acid

C24H22O14 (534.1009512)


Luteolin 7-malonylglucoside, also known as luteolin 7-O-B-D-(6-O-malonyl) glucopyranoside, is a member of the class of compounds known as flavonoid-7-o-glycosides. Flavonoid-7-o-glycosides are phenolic compounds containing a flavonoid moiety which is O-glycosidically linked to carbohydrate moiety at the C7-position. Luteolin 7-malonylglucoside is practically insoluble (in water) and a weakly acidic compound (based on its pKa). Luteolin 7-malonylglucoside can be found in celery leaves, globe artichoke, and wild celery, which makes luteolin 7-malonylglucoside a potential biomarker for the consumption of these food products.

Kaempferol 3-O-(6-malonyl-glucoside)

3-{[(2R,3S,4S,5R,6S)-6-{[5,7-dihydroxy-2-(4-hydroxyphenyl)-4-oxo-4H-chromen-3-yl]oxy}-3,4,5-trihydroxyoxan-2-yl]methoxy}-3-oxopropanoic acid

C24H22O14 (534.1009512)


Kaempferol 3-o-(6"-malonyl-glucoside) is a member of the class of compounds known as flavonoid-3-o-glycosides. Flavonoid-3-o-glycosides are phenolic compounds containing a flavonoid moiety which is O-glycosidically linked to carbohydrate moiety at the C3-position. Kaempferol 3-o-(6"-malonyl-glucoside) is practically insoluble (in water) and a weakly acidic compound (based on its pKa). Kaempferol 3-o-(6"-malonyl-glucoside) can be found in endive and lettuce, which makes kaempferol 3-o-(6"-malonyl-glucoside) a potential biomarker for the consumption of these food products.
